Exports In 2023, Portugal exported $103M in Petroleum Gas, making it the 74th largest exporter of Petroleum Gas in the world. At the same year, Petroleum Gas was the 166th most exported product in Portugal. The main destination of Petroleum Gas exports from Portugal are: Spain ($42.1M), Germany ($24.8M), Morocco ($21.6M), Tunisia ($6.89M), and Poland ($2.37M).

The fastest growing export markets for Petroleum Gas of Portugal between 2022 and 2023 were Germany ($24.8M), Morocco ($15.3M), and Tunisia ($2.98M).

Imports In 2023, Portugal imported $2.33B in Petroleum Gas, becoming the 36th largest importer of Petroleum Gas in the world. At the same year, Petroleum Gas was the 6th most imported product in Portugal. Portugal imports Petroleum Gas primarily from: United States ($870M), Spain ($523M), Nigeria ($508M), Russia ($207M), and Trinidad and Tobago ($98.6M).

The fastest growing import markets in Petroleum Gas for Portugal between 2022 and 2023 were Russia ($69.5M), Norway ($27.9M), and Sweden ($7.18M).
